We did sign up one too many bands by accident, when you run a popular event stuff like that happens. This caused Rock Band Score Tournament to run long so we told all remaining competitors that they could play just before the showmanship tournament which was 3 and a half hours after their regularly scheduled play time.

Did you not play in the Showmanship tournament?

If you did play then that means you would have had to wait until 7pm to play in that tournament anyway. Which is why this should not have been a problem. We knew the last round was the best players and they would likely want to compete in Showmanship anyway.

Sorry really long post just to say we did the best we could with this Brand New Game that honestly has not been properly tested in large scale tournament environments.

We made Rock Band the focus of our largest room for hours on end and allowed bands to have as many spectators as they wanted. No other tournament had this luxury.

ok now I understand your issue much better. I was really confused there for a bit.

We learned an amazing amount this year (as always) and will hopefully be able to time the Rock Band competition more accurately.

If my darn Online Registration System had worked properly none of this would have been an issue because we would have signed up 9 bands (8 entries plus 1 backup band) fully online and would not have wasted that time at the event.

We are still working on online registration right now, so surely by 2009 it will be complete and the 4 our delay will be a non-issue.

Of course by then that Rock Band Tour Bus might actually get it's funding back and they can come run this event for us :-)

Sorry for brining back an old topic, but I have learned a lot from this discussion and taken many notes that will help us next year.

#1 being that Some Bands only want to do Score Tournaments, I honestly had no idea this would happen.
